Make your house look like it’s always occupied. You could purchase timers and have your TVs, lights, radios and other types of electronics to go on at various times. This way, it will appear that you are at home. This helps you keep your house burglar-free.

Don’t post information about your vacations on social media. While it is exciting to go to a new place and have a good time, you’re letting everyone know that your home will be vacant and easy to rob.

Buy a safe to contain everything of great value. This is vital if you don’t want diamonds, gold or other personal items exposed to a home intruder. Keep the safe hidden in a hard-to-find location like an attic or a basement closet.

If the home you are moving into is not brand new, you should change the locks right away. The person who used to live there may still have made some copies of the key. You can change the locks yourself to ascertain that only you have a key.

Do not allow anyone you do not know into your home. While their story may seem legit, that doesn’t mean it is true. There are some people who will just come in to see if you have a home security system, and if you do not, they could come back later when you are not home.

Be certain to read the fine print to any contracts you plan on signing for a home security firm. There are sometimes fees for terminating the contract early or acquiring additional equipment. You want to avoid as many of these fees as you can, so know about them up front.

Never throw out boxes for expensive items until the day your trash is picked up. Having these boxes nearby can tell robbers what kind of merchandise you’ve got in your house.

Always ask for references before letting a contractor or a maid in your home. A background check is also recommended so you know if they have a criminal history. You can’t always be sure that maids, service workers or contractors are honest, and therefore giving out keys can be a big error.

Spring Latch Locks

Don’t use locks of the spring latch locks installed. These are very easy to pick by using a credit card. Intruders just have to slide a card in between the latch and door for the door. Add a deadbolt to existing spring latch locks.

When you aren’t home, be sure to close your blinds, curtains or shades. Leaving your windows unguarded exposes the interior of your home to everyone, including criminals looking for tempting targets. They may break in if they see things they like. Your window dressing should also be closed while you sleep.
